The following presentations from the Gelato ICE GCC track (April 24
and 25) can be found at:
http://www.gelato.org/community/gelato_meeting.php?id=ICE06aprT
(see bottom of left index column entitled "Focus on GCC" for links)
- The ISP RAS Effort to Improve GCC for Itanium, Arutyun Avetisyan
- GCC IP Issues, Dan Berlin
- Open64: An Alternative Backend for GCC, Shin-Ming Liu
- Aliasing in GCC, Dan Berlin
- Superblock Update, Robert Kidd
- An Interblock VLIW-Targeted Instruction Scheduler for GCC,
Andrey Belevantsev
- Parallel Programming with GCC, Diego Novillo
- LTO: A Brief Introduction, Mark Mitchell
- LLVM: A Brief Introduction, Chris Lattner
